1. 誠實的;正直的
If you describe someone as honest, you mean that they always tell the truth, and do not try to deceive people or break the law.

e.g. My dad was the most honest man I ever met...
爸爸是我所見過的最正直的人。
e.g. I know she's honest and reliable.
我知道她誠實可靠。
2. 坦誠的;直率的;不隱瞞真相的
If you are honest in a particular situation, you tell the complete truth or give your sincere opinion, even if this is not very pleasant.

e.g. I was honest about what I was doing...
我對自己所做的事情并無隱瞞。
e.g. He had been honest with her and she had tricked him!...
他對她坦誠相見,而她卻騙了他!
3. 真的;確實
You say 'honest' before or after a statement to emphasize that you are telling the truth and that you want people to believe you.

e.g. I'm not sure, honest.
我不能肯定,真的。
4. (表示強調(diào))真的,實在,千真萬確
Some people say 'honest to God' to emphasize their feelings or to emphasize that something is really true.
e.g. I wish we weren't doing this, Lillian, honest to God, I really do...
我希望我們沒有在干這事,莉蓮,真的,我真這么想。
e.g. You wanna know the honest-to-God truth?
你想知道真正的事實嗎?
5. 老實說;說實在的
You can say 'to be honest' before or after a statement to indicate that you are telling the truth about your own opinions or feelings, especially if you think these will disappoint the person you are talking to.
e.g. To be honest the house is not quite our style...
說實話,這所房子不太適合我們。
e.g. I'd rather get it out the way, to be honest.
老實說,我情愿把它處理掉。
